Hi xiaoa123,

If you can wait until 21st Aug (1 week away), Intel will be launching Coffee Lake CPUs, then it will be better to wait and compare between Intel & AMD. You can always buy the rest of your components first (besides the casing) while waiting for the CPU.

But if you need to buy your PC now, I have the following suggestions (shop names in brackets). Ryzen 3 can be overclocked using B350 motherboards.

Prices shown before any discounts:

CPU & MB Bundle: Ryzen 3 1200 & Asrock AB350M Pro 4 @ $297 (PC Themes)
RAM: G.Skill 2400Mhz 8GB @ $90 (PC Themes)
GPU: Palit GTX1060 StormX 3GB GDDR5 @ $298.50 (Lazada)
SSD: Western Digital Blue 250GB M.2 @ $136 (Lazada)
Hard Disk: Toshiba 1TB 7200RPM @ $63 (PC Themes)
Casing & Power Supply Bundle: Tecware F3 & FSP Hexa+ 450W @ $80 (Tradepac)
OS: Windows 10 @ ~$12 (Carousell)

Total Cost = $976.50
